Veza Manufacturing Acquires Tornik Mexico Facility
March 19, 2026
Veza Manufacturing acquired Tornik, LLC’s manufacturing operations in Tijuana, Mexico, expanding Veza’s global footprint. The newly integrated facility will operate as Veza Mexico within the IMMEX maquiladora program and is equipped for wire & cable harness and electromechanical assembly production for the medical market.
